About the Team

We are looking for a highly motivated and Senior Engineer to join our growing Infrastructure and Platform Engineering team. You will play a critical role in building, scaling, observing and maintaining our Kubernetes-based platform and enabling our engineering organization to deliver capabilities and incremental products quickly and reliably. You will have the opportunity to work with cutting-edge technologies, solve complicated problems, and contribute to the foundation of our infrastructure. This role requires a strong technical background, a passion for automation, and a collaborative mindset.
This role involves collaborating with teams across multiple locations and time zones. You will need to be adept at communicating optimally and building positive relationships with colleagues in diverse locations.

About the Role

You have a growth mindset and will be part of a team promoting a diverse and inclusive environment where you and your workmates are happy, energized and engaged, and who are excited to come to work every day.

Responsibilities:

  • Design and implement: Build, develop, and implement solutions for our Kubernetes platform, including infrastructure automation, CI/CD pipelines, and observability tools.

  • Build and maintain: Build and maintain core platform components, ensuring high availability, scalability, and security.

  • Automate and optimize: Automate infrastructure provisioning, configuration management, and application deployments using tools like Terraform and Argo CD.

  • Troubleshooting and support: Provide support and solving for platform-related issues, working closely with peer development teams to resolve problems.

  • Security and compliance: Implement and maintain security standard methodologies for the platform, ensuring compliance with industry standards.

  • Documentation and knowledge sharing: Build and maintain comprehensive documentation for platform components and processes. Actively participate in knowledge sharing within the team.

  • Collaborate effectively with other engineers and development teams across multiple locations and time zones.

  • Stay up-to-date with the latest technologies and trends in the platform engineering space.

Our Approach to Flexible Work
 

With Flex Work, we’re combining the best of both worlds: in-person time and remote. Our approach enables our teams to deepen connections, maintain a strong community, and do their best work. We know that flexibility can take shape in many ways, so rather than a number of required days in-office each week, we simply spend at least half (50%) of our time each quarter in the office or in the field with our customers, prospects, and partners (depending on role). This means you'll have the freedom to create a flexible schedule that caters to your business, team, and personal needs, while being intentional to make the most of time spent together. Those in our remote "home office" roles also have the opportunity to come together in our offices for important moments that matter.

What We Do

Workday is a leading provider of enterprise cloud applications for finance, HR, and planning. Founded in 2005, Workday delivers financial management, human capital management, and analytics applications designed for the world’s largest companies, educational institutions, and government agencies. Organizations ranging from medium-sized businesses to Fortune 50 enterprises have selected Workday.
